For those who are not familiar, The Trevor Project is the world's largest suicide prevention and crisis intervention organization for LGBTQ+ young people. Estimates suggests that more than 1.8 million LGBTQ+ youth between the ages of 13 and 24 in the United States seriouslyconsider suicide each year.

Geologists estimate that more than 70 percent of the world’s volcanoes are hidden under the sea at mid-ocean ridges: divergent plate boundaries where two oceanic plates are pulling apart.

The estimates are that one in five adults in America experience a mental illness, and one in 25 live with a serious mental illness.
